Now, Denmark, in response to all this, has dispatched additional troops to Greenland on Monday today, and President Trump declined to rule out using force to seize control of the vast Arctic Island. The Danish defense forces said that a plane with a, quote, substantial contribution of soldiers and the head of the country's army would land in Kangaloswak in the west of the autonomous territory. And that is added to the fact that European nations have sent additional troops to Greenland as these threats. have happened. This is four days ago. These are our allies. European NATO countries are deploying
Starting point is 00:03:23 small numbers of military personnel to Greenland to participate in joint exercises with Denmark as Donald Trump ramps up his threats to forcibly annex the Arctic Island. Those countries are Germany, Sweden, France, Norway, the Netherlands, and Finland have all since confirmed their sending military personnel. Canada and France have also said that they planned to open consulence in nuke Greenland's capital in the coming weeks. in response to this, Donald Trump has said that he's going to give a 10% tariff on each European nation that has a military presence in Greenland and it's going up to 25% if they stay until June. Now, that means that European goods, along with everything else, is about to get more expensive.
